Chapter 519: We Will Be Enemies When We Meet Again!

Luo Chen, Du Xiangyang, Song Tingyu, Xie Jingxuan, Pang Qianqian, and Xue Moyan used their mind consciousnesses to examine the tokens at their waists.

“All of the eastern barbarians have come to a halt!”

Pan Qianqian exclaimed as she turned to look behind them, astonishment clear on her face.

The rest of Qin Lie’s group looked at Gao Yu, with strange expressions on their faces.

It was obvious to everyone present that the eastern barbarians stopped approaching because the girl named Jia Yue had blown the horn. They were obeying her command.

That same Jia Yue had listened to Gao Yu and given up on threatening them.

“What exactly is going on here, Gao Yu?” Song Tingyu sighed softly, some of the tension flowing out of her.

However, Gao Yu ignored her and only looked at Qin Lie.

Qin Lie frowned at him in return.

After a long period of silence, Gao Yu’s sinister expression gradually softened.

“You were actually going to give the Demon Sealing Tombstone up to save me…” he said softly, his tone deep and low.

It was then that everyone realized… that this whole charade had been Gao Yu testing Qin Lie.

“Why?” The expression on Qin Lie’s face was so heavy that one could wring water from it.

“After everything that happened in Icestone City and the Nether Realm… we parted ways. When we met again at Sea Moon Island, you seemed to have changed a lot.” Gao Yu paused for a moment, contemplating something, then continued, “I wanted to know if you were the same Qin Lie I knew many years ago.

“I wanted to know if… deep in your heart… you still considered me your friend.”

Qin Lie stayed silent.

He understood that merging with a part of who he used to be had slightly changed his demeanor. He was, indeed, different.

Gao Yu did all of this just to confirm how different Qin Lie had become.

“What would have happened to us if Qin Lie hadn’t taken the Demon Sealing Tombstone out to save you?” Du Xiangyang asked cheerfully, his anxiety forgotten.

“All of you would’ve died!” Gao Yu exclaimed harshly, sweeping a glance over him.

And immediately after they thought they could relax, everyone froze up again.

“Jia Yue leads the white barbarians. A dozen or so of them were pursuing you from behind, all of which are in the late stage of the Netherpassage Realm,” Gao Yu said apathetically. “In addition to that, dozens of white barbarian elites lay in wait a kilometer and a half ahead of here. You had no chance of surviving this.”

Upon hearing this, each of them felt a chill well up from the bottom of their hearts. Palpable fear leaked from their eyes.

Assuming Gao Yu wasn’t lying to them, then dozens of white barbarian elites were both right behind them as well as blocking the road ahead. Adding them to Jia Yue, who was clearly quite powerful, and Gao Yu, whose current strength was unknown… Qin Lie’s group might have really died then and there.

“The eastern barbarians have already slaughtered every single martial practitioner from the Land of Chaos who wandered into the Forbidden Lands of Earth, Water, and Metal,” Gao Yu said in a low tone. He paused, eyeing Qin Lie’s group one by one, then continued, “Several hundred black, scarlet, and white barbarians are in the Forbidden Land of Ice right now. They possess tokens from each of the nine great Silver rank forces. They are the hunters, and all of you are just… prey.”

Advertisement

This news made Qin Lie’s group go pale.

They had guessed that there would be a lot of eastern barbarians in the area, but they didn’t think that several hundred of them would enter the Graveyard of Gods. Furthermore, the barbarians swept through the other three forbidden lands and killed every Land of Chaos martial practitioner they came across.

Seeing their expressions, Gao Yu sighed deeply.

“I suggest that you get rid of your tokens as soon as possible. If you do, you might be able to keep the eastern barbarians from tracking you down and killing you.”

“What is your relationship with Jia Yue?” Qin Lie asked, frowning.

After a moment of hesitation, Gao Yu answered.

“When I fell into the Forbidden Land of Metal, martial practitioners of Black Voodoo Cult and the Xiahou Family hunted me relentlessly. Jia Yue was also being hunted. She had strayed from her fellow tribesmen and gotten lost. The two of us had no choice but to work together to survive. When I suffered a grave injury, she was the one who carried me on her back and helped me escape Black Voodoo Cult and the Xiahou Family’s encirclement. She’s the only reason I survived. I owe her…”

“You say you owe her…” Song Tingyu interrupted. “Yet it seems like she values your opinion quite a bit.”

“She values my opinion because, once I recovered, I’ve helped her lead the white barbarians in killing Black Voodoo Cult and Xiahou Family martial practitioners,” Gao Yu retorted coldly.

A chill ran through everyone’s bodies yet again.

“Will you be staying with the white barbarians?” Qin Lie asked solemnly.

“I made a promise to Jia Yue.” Gao Yu’s face slowly turned grim. “I will help her keep her promise to her tribesmen, hunt her enemies in the Graveyard of Gods, and seize the remains of the elites in the Land of Buried Gods. This means that we’ll be enemies the moment we part ways!”

This declaration startled Qin Lie.

“I will become your enemy!” Gao Yu yelled, looking at Luo Chen, Xue Moyan, and the others. “Back in the Forbidden Land of Metal, I didn’t kill just Black Voodoo Cult and Xiahou Family martial practitioners. I killed every martial practitioner I came across, including those of other forces!”

Luo Chen and Xue Moyan’s eyes went cold.

“One more thing…” Gao Yu shook his head and laughed coldly. “Ye Yihao was the one who told Jia Yue where you were and that you had the Pure Soul Springs.

“The black, scarlet, and white barbarians may clash from time to time, but they are incredibly united when it comes to battling foreign enemies. Killing the martial practitioners of the Land of Chaos is the top priority of every eastern barbarian. The martial practitioners of the Land of Chaos, on the other hand, continue to fight each other. It is their destiny to be buried in the Graveyard of Gods.

“Qin Lie! Next time we meet, you and I will be enemies!”

After making this declaration, Gao Yu resolutely moved in the direction that Jia Yue had gone. His figure disappeared into the distance, ghastly shadows following in his wake.

A dense, unfathomably dark aura radiated from his body, making it look as if he had been possessed by thousands of ghosts.

A moment after Gao Yu left, Xie Jingxuan spoke up.

“Gao Yu must have had a fortuitous encounter here in the Graveyard of Gods. His biomagnetic field is incredibly strong… actually, it’s slightly stronger than Yu Men’s. At the very least, he must’ve reached the middle stage of the Netherpassage Realm.”

Advertisement

“How can he possess such a terrifying aura at just the middle stage of the Netherpassage Realm?” Du Xiangyang asked grimly..

“Sometimes… strength isn’t related to one’s realm.” Luo Chen subconsciously glanced at Qin Lie.

In Luo Chen’s eyes, Qin Lie’s realm was average at best. However, he was capable of accomplishing astonishing things over and over.

“This Gao Yu is incredibly strong,” Xue Moyan said in a low voice.

“What’ll you do if we meet him again?” Du Xiangyang looked at Qin Lie.

“…that depends on the situation!”

……

“Gao Yu has returned!”

Sixteen white barbarians were positioned behind Qin Lie’s group. Shields of light covered their bodies, and they carried giant bows on their backs. Their eyes resembled lightning against their pale white faces.

These white barbarians consisted of men and women between twenty and forty years old.

Yet all of them were in the late stage of the Netherpassage Realm.

Jia Yue stood right in the middle of them.

When they saw Gao Yu return, relief showed on their faces as they collectively sighed.

They had been worried that Gao Yu wouldn’t return after meeting Qin Lie.

Before this, the white barbarians hadn’t trusted Gao Yu. They had looked down on him and scorned him. However, through his violent, ruthless slaughtering of Land of Chaos martial practitioners, he had slowly won their trust and respect.

And all of them had noticed the love that had secretly developed between him and their tribe’s beloved daughter, Jia Yue.

Gao Yu’s cultivation of the Nine Hell Wandering Soul Record, the Evil God inheritance he received from the Nether Realm, and his dark, ruthless personality won the recognition of all the white barbarians. All of that even helped them approve of his relationship with Jia Yue.

They all thought that the future of the White Barbarian Tribe would be bright if Gao Yu became Jia Yue’s husband.

Gao Yu clearly possessed limitless potential, his heart was as firm as steel, and his methods were extremely effective. He would definitely become a firm pillar of support for Jia Yue in the future.

At the same time, Jia Yue would eventually become a tribe elder. She was, quite literally, the White Barbarian Tribe’s future.

“We shall leave Qin Lie to others,” Gao Yu said indifferently. “Let us head to the Land of Buried Gods first.”

“Whatever you say.” Jia Yue smiled faintly.

“Gao Yu!” a big barbarian yelled in a low voice. “What shall we do if we meet that group in the Land of Buried Gods?”

This question weighed upon the hearts of many of them.

“When we meet again, we will be enemies!” Gao Yu exclaimed in a low tone.

“Good!” The barbarian laughed loudly. “We trust you, Gao Yu! We can truly relax now that we have your word!”

……

“Should we do what Gao Yu suggested and throw away all of our tokens?”

Song Tingyu suddenly spoke up.

Qin Lie’s group was currently using the Demon Sealing tombstone to determine their course again and start heading toward the ice spirit.

“There are several hundred eastern barbarians, and all of them have tokens they can use to track us. It is obviously disadvantageous for us to continue carrying them,” Xie Jingxuan added.

“The tokens aren’t only used to communicate between forces. They can also be used to determine where the passageways out of the Graveyard of Gods are once the Trial ends.” Du Xiangyang smiled bitterly.

This information surprised Qin Lie, Song Tingyu, and Xie Jingxuan.

“You guys weren’t aware of that?” Du Xiangyang asked, stunned.

The three of them shook their heads.

“The spatial passageways we used to enter the Graveyard of Gods were sealed from the outside, which is why we are currently unable to use the tokens to sense them,” Du Xiangyang explained. “However, once the Trial ends, the people outside will reopen the passageways. When that time comes, every token in our possession will be able to tell us where those passageways are. There are no other ways for us to leave the Graveyard of Gods to return to the Land of Chaos!”

“We’ve been in here for half a year. The Trial will end once another six months passes,” Pan Qianqian said. “As long as we’re still alive by then, we’ll be able to return to the Land of Chaos even if we don’t manage to get anything from the Graveyard of Gods. We’d be able to collect the rewards that all of the forces put up for grabs!”

“Does that mean we can’t just discard our tokens then?” Song Tingyu asked, her expression bitter. “They literally paint a target on our backs! We could be discovered by the eastern barbarians at any moment in the Forbidden Land of Ice!”

“We’ll only need one token if we just stay together,” Du Xiangyang said after some careful consideration. “With just one token, the probability of the eastern barbarians finding us will drop significantly. Then we’ll be able to figure out where the passageways are in half a year and leave this place.”

As the group spoke amongst each other, Qin Lie quietly examined the interior of a sword token with a wisp of mind consciousness.

He was carefully analyzing the spirit diagram inside of it.

A while later, he said, “We don’t need to throw the tokens away. I can alter the spirit diagrams inside of them and render them temporarily useless. Once we need them, I can readjust the spirit diagrams and reactivate them.”

Chapter 520: Finally Free!

“Big Brother Qin, you even know how to forge artifacts?”

Tiny stars shone in Pan Qianqian’s eyes, her face filled with admiration. She became increasingly convinced of how amazing Qin Lie really was.

Aside from Song Tingyu and Xie Jingxuan, the rest of the group wore expressions of amazement. They looked as if they had discovered a new continent.

“Seriously?” Du Xiangyang exclaimed in surprise. “You know how to forge artifacts too?”

“He’s the most talented artificer that our Scarlet Tide Continent has seen in a thousand years!” Song Tingyu declared proudly. “He forged all of his Terminator Profound Bombs with his own hands!”

The Land of Chaos martial practitioners of the group grew more and more astonished.

“Master Meng, who personally forged all of the sword tokens, is Heavenly Sword Mountain’s most prolific artificer. He can forge artifacts up to Earth Grade Five or Six!” Luo Chen snorted in disdain. “Qin Lie, are you saying that you can alter a spirit diagram that Master Meng himself constructed?”

Luo Chen’s words suddenly caused Du Xiangyang to doubt Qin Lie as well.

Du Xiangyang also came from Heavenly Sword Mountain, and he was well aware of how impressive Master Meng was.

How could the spirit diagram of such a master artificer be so easily tampered with?

“A master artificer capable of forging Earth Grade Five or Six spirit artifacts!”

This information shocked Song Tingyu. The pride on her face swiftly faded, worry clearly starting to replace it.

The number of master artificers in all of the Scarlet Tide Continent could be counted on one hand. Even Armament Sect’s Mo Hai, a publicly acknowledged master, could only forge spirit artifacts up to Profound Grade Seven.

Qin Lie may have displayed extraordinary talent at Armament Sect and triggered reactions in all twelve spirit pattern pillars, but he had started forging artifacts a bit late. He couldn’t be more skilled at artificing than Mo Hai… could he?

Song Tingyu suddenly felt that it had been kind of ridiculous for her to be proud of Qin Lie.

All of them stared at Qin Lie with doubt in their eyes.

“I can neither forge a sword token nor inscribe the spirit diagram inside of it,” Qin Lie said, a calm, confident smile on his face. “However… I don’t believe that altering a few spirit strands to adjust the spirit diagram will prove to be much of a problem.”

“Every single spirit strand in a spirit diagram is essential!” Luo Chen exclaimed in a low tone. “Tinkering with even one of them could cause the entire spirit diagram to collapse!”

The others were on the fence, half believing in Qin Lie and half doubting him.

Qin Lie just smiled and shook his head, staying silent. Under their anxious gazes, he pressed a finger to the sword token in his hand.

The moment he touched the sword token, his fingertip sparked with dazzling spirit light that resembled the tip of an otherworldly pen.

In the same instant, a wisp of his mind consciousness pierced into the sword token and entered the world of the spirit diagram.

All compound spirit diagrams, which were made by combining other spirits diagrams into one, normally consisted of the basic four: Spirit Storage, Spirit Gathering, Amplification, and Strengthening.

Two of the basic spirit diagrams, Spirit Storage and Amplification, could be seen in the sword token’s compound spirit diagram. At the center of the two, however, was a rather complicated spiral-shaped spirit diagram.

At first glance, the spirit diagram resembled a spiral funnel that constantly radiated strange spirit energy.

The mouth of the funnel diagram generated a suction force that seemed to be drawing something into it.

The basic Spirit Storage diagram contained sword spirit energy, which was the power source for the sword token. It had been sealed into that diagram to provide energy for all of the compound diagrams.

Traces of the sword spirit energy flowed from the Spirit Storage diagram. After being enhanced by the Amplification diagram, that energy then moved to power the funnel-shaped spirit diagram, allowing it to release fluctuations as it absorbed waves of energy from outside of the token. Whenever it did, a low, droning sound would resonate from that diagram, transmitting information to and from its owner…

With just glance, Qin Lie quickly saw through the secrets of the three spirit diagrams in the sword token, then turned his attention to the Spirit Storage diagram.

This diagram was still much simpler than the one he had learned and mastered. It paled in comparison.

Concentrating his wisp of mind consciousness, Qin Lie gathered it around three threads of the Spirit Storage diagram. With a thought, he twisted the threads with spirit energy, forcing them to become oddly tangled..

This led to an abrupt change in the entirety of the Spirit Storage diagram. The tangled knot of spirit threads instantly blocked the passage through which energy had constantly flowed.

This kept the sword spirit energy within the Spirit Storage diagram from reaching the rest of the compound spirit diagram.

All spirit diagrams needed energy to function. Without energy, the funnel-shaped spirit diagram immediately stopped transmitting and receiving information. This resulted in the most important function of the sword token forcefully shutting down.

Qin Lie’s mind consciousness exited the sword token.

The sword token he held in one hand, which had originally been shining brightly, suddenly went dim.

“Give it a try,” Qin Lie said to Luo Chen. “See if you can sense this with the sword token you possess.”

Confused, Luo Chen grabbed the sword token at his waist, staring at Qin Lie with cold eyes. He used his soul consciousness to activate it.

“Eeeeeeeen…”

The sword tokens that hung from the waists of everyone else in the group began to ring. However, Qin Lie’s sword token didn’t respond at all.

This development left everyone stunned.

“Did you really render it useless?” Song Tingyu asked uncertainly.

Qin Lie wore a casual expression and didn’t bother trying to explain. Instead, he grabbed the other tokens at his waist and examined them just like he did with the sword token.

He discovered that the compound diagrams of all the tokens were essentially the same. Although the core diagrams differed greatly, all of them used the Spirit Storage and Amplification diagrams as a basis. In addition to that, the core diagrams did the same thing: receive and transmit information.

After giving each token a once-over, Qin Lie confidently said, “Other than the main diagram, the rest of the compound spirit diagram is mostly the same from token to token. I can alter the spirit diagram of any token and make them stop functioning for the time being.”

This time no one else doubted him. Everyone’s eyes gushed with joy.

“You’re so amazing, Big Brother Qin!” Pan Qianqian cried in admiration.

Wonder filled Xue Moyan’s eyes. She continuously found Qin Lie increasingly difficult to understand. Too many things about him couldn’t be explained in a normal way.

Luo Chen and Du Xiangyang were also inwardly surprised. Every time they looked at Qin Lie, they underestimated him less and less.

This guy possessed power in the martial way that everyone acknowledged, yet he was also amazingly skilled in forging artifacts. How in Spirit Realm did he cultivate?

An ugly expression covered Luo Chen’s face as he recalled Li Mu’s humiliating evaluation of him.

The Sixth Heavenly Sword had told Luo Chen he wasn’t qualified to become his disciple, yet the man had a great relationship with Qin Lie and wanted to take him on as his true disciple.

For the longest time, Luo Chen thought that Li Mu didn’t mean what he said, that his words were meant to purposefully humiliate him and wound his pride.

Upon learning of Qin Lie’s existence, Luo Chen had targeted him time and time again, just so that he could prove Li Mu wrong.

He also did this to prove his superiority.

However, as he continued to learn more about Qin Lie, and as Qin Lie displayed more miraculous feats, he couldn’t help but think that Li Mu had been right all along!

Qin Lie seemed to be… more talented than him in every way. He was definitely more qualified than Luo Chen to become Li Mu’s true disciple.

This realization struck Luo Chen across the head like the flat of a sword, putting him into a daze. A myriad of complicated feelings welled inside of his heart.

As Luo Chen stood there, stunned, Qin Lie took everybody’s tokens and altered the spirit diagrams inside of them.

A few minutes later, every token that their group possessed temporarily stopped functioning.

Since the tokens could no longer transmit or receive information, this meant that, from this point onward, no one could use them to track their position!

……

“They disappeared!”

“They were just twenty five kilometers from us. Why has their energy suddenly disappeared?”

“How strange!”

At the foot of a snow-covered mountain, the group of martial practitioners from Black Voodoo Sect, the three great families, Celestial Artifact Sect, and Ten Thousand Beast Mountain muttered amongst themselves, odd expressions on their faces.

“The white barbarians must have caught up to them and slaughtered them.” Ye Yihao laughed coldly. “Their tokens must have been destroyed along with them, preventing us from detecting their location.”

“That should be the case.” Xiahou Yuan smiled sinisterly.

“It’s such a shame, though!” Huang Zhuli cried, gritting her teeth. “Qin Lie had the Demon Sealing Tombstone and the Pure Soul Springs! They even had the Spring of Life!”

“Perhaps we should move in that direction?” Feng Yiyou suggested. “Maybe the white barbarians suffered huge losses in the process?”

Everyone’s eyes lit up at the prospect. After a moment of discussion, they decided on that as their next plan.

All of them moved in the direction that Qin Lie’s group had initially been. Soon enough, they detected several dozen eastern barbarians that were supposedly blocking the path to Qin Lie’s group and swiftly charged toward them.

……

While the three forces were committing suicide, Qin Lie’s group, having disappeared from everyone’s radar, continued to follow the Demon Sealing Tombstone and hurry on their way.

They were completely unaware of the terrible lesson that the white barbarians were teaching the three forces as a result of Qin Lie altering the tokens.

So they continued to approach the ice spirit.

As of this moment, Qin Lie borrowed soul crystals from the others and gripped the Demon Sealing Tombstone, preparing to replenish his soul energy and his blood once the Soul Suppressing Orb drained them from him.

He sat on the snowy ground, inhaled deeply, and inwardly shouted, “Come!”

He waited for the Soul Suppressing Orb’s never-ending demand for his soul energy and blood.

His companions watched him helplessly. They knew that the soul energy and the blood he had accumulated to this point would probably be completely drained from him again.

“Eh?” Qin Lie exclaimed a few minutes later, confusion filling his face.

“What is it?” Song Tingyu asked softly.

“Nothing’s been drained! Nothing’s happening!” Qin Lie said, eyes wide with surprise. “Previously, every time I managed to replenish my soul energy and blood, they would immediately be extracted. This time, however, nothing has happened.”

“Are you saying that… it’s stopped?” The notion came as a pleasant surprise to her.

“That seems to be the case.” Qin Lie nodded.

“I think that the amount of soul energy and blood that the thing inside you extracted from your body has probably become enough to trigger some sort of extraordinary change,” Du Xiangyang said while rubbing his chin. “In order words, after allowing it to drain you for so long, you’ve finally fulfilled its requirements.”

“So you think I’m finally free?” Qin Lie asked, joy filling his heart.

The entire time he had been subdued by the Soul Suppressing Orb, Qin Lie experienced intense fear and hopelessness.

He hadn’t the slightest clue when this cycle of constant draining and replenishing would come to an end.

He actually hadn’t expected it to ever end…

But the instant it did, he relaxed.
